patio step edgingBeyond safety and convenience, using anti-spill mats also aligns with sustainability efforts. Many of these mats are made from eco-friendly materials, making them a better choice for environmentally conscious consumers. By containing spills effectively, they help in minimizing waste and reducing cleanup efforts, which often involve the use of additional resources and chemicals. Furthermore, by preventing spills, these mats help protect flooring and other surfaces from deterioration, reducing the need for repairs and replacements, and ultimately contributing to a more sustainable approach in maintaining facilities.

patio step edging3. Noise Reduction Rubber’s inherent properties offer excellent sound insulation. With a properly installed glazing bead, exterior noises can be significantly reduced, creating a quieter and more peaceful indoor environment. This is particularly beneficial in urban settings where noise pollution can be a concern.

In the marine sector, flat rubber strips are essential for maintaining boats and yachts. They are often applied along the edges of hatches and doors to prevent water intrusion. The ability of rubber to resist saltwater and UV exposure ensures that these strips last for prolonged periods in harsh environments.

One of the primary advantages of installing a sliding door sweep is its contribution to energy efficiency. Gaps at the bottom of sliding doors can allow air drafts to enter, making heating and cooling systems work harder to maintain indoor temperatures. In colder months, warm air can escape, leading to higher heating bills. Conversely, in warmer climates, hot air can seep in, increasing air conditioning costs.

Anti-fog plastics are engineered materials that have been treated or coated to reduce the occurrence of condensation buildup. This condensation leads to fogging, which can obstruct vision. Anti-fog technologies work primarily through two methods hydrophilic and hydrophobic treatments. Hydrophilic coatings spread moisture evenly across the surface, preventing bead formation and allowing for improved clarity. In contrast, hydrophobic treatments repel water, causing it to bead up and roll off the surface instead of clinging to it.

Ammonia is a toxic byproduct of protein metabolism. In healthy individuals, the liver efficiently eliminates ammonia by converting it into urea through the urea cycle. However, in liver dysfunction or cirrhosis, this detoxification process is impaired, leading to the accumulation of ammonia in the bloodstream. This condition, known as hyperammonemia, can result in serious neurological complications, collectively referred to as hepatic encephalopathy. Symptoms may range from mild confusion to severe cognitive decline, indicating the brain's sensitivity to elevated ammonia levels.
Once an API is identified, formulating it into a usable medication involves the incorporation of excipients. Excipients are inactive substances that serve as carriers for the API. They play several key roles in drug formulation, including improving the stability and bioavailability of the active ingredient, aiding in the manufacturing process, and ensuring the drug is easy and pleasant for patients to consume. Common excipients include fillers, binders, disintegrants, lubricants, and preservatives, which collectively support the API in achieving its therapeutic goal.

Given the potential impact of APIs on public health, the manufacturing processes are subject to strict regulations. Regulatory agencies, such as the U.S. Food and Drug Administration (FDA) and the European Medicines Agency (EMA), enforce Good Manufacturing Practices (GMP) to ensure the quality and safety of APIs. These regulations require rigorous quality control and assurance measures throughout the manufacturing process.

Coenzyme Q10, a fat-soluble substance, is crucial for the production of adenosine triphosphate (ATP), the primary energy carrier in cells. Naturally occurring in the body, CoQ10 is found in high concentrations in the heart, liver, and kidneys. Its role as an electron carrier in the mitochondrial respiratory chain is vital for energy metabolism. Additionally, CoQ10 is a powerful antioxidant, helping to neutralize free radicals that can cause oxidative stress and damage cellular structures.
